The CMP credential is recognized globally as the badge of excellence in the events industry. The qualifications for certification are based on professional experience, education, and passing a very rigorous exam. Meeting professionals who hold the CMP earn more than $10,000 annually than their non-certified counterparts, on average. Like any other certification, the CMP credential opens the door to better and more opportunities.
